Check local listings and online platforms for viewing options in your area. The Houston Astros, a team with a storied past, have become a staple in Major League Baseball (MLB) since their inception. Founded in 1962, the Astros began as the Houston Colt .45s before adopting their current name in 1965, coinciding with their move to the Astrodome, the world's first multi-purpose domed sports stadium. Over the decades, the Astros have experienced their fair share of highs and lows, with moments of brilliance and periods of rebuilding.
